]> git.sesse.net Git - bcachefs-tools-debian/blobdiff - cmd_fs.c
Add rust toolchain to debian build-deps
[bcachefs-tools-debian] / cmd_fs.c
index 195ad302daa2f55d28f603a8a1bcecb0621fb67b..007c8d87a64fca68422f2de6f904d2221cfa97f3 100644 (file)
--- a/cmd_fs.c
+++ b/cmd_fs.c
@@ -179,8 +179,9 @@ static void fs_usage_to_text(struct printbuf *out, const char *path)
        pr_uuid(out, fs.uuid.b);
        prt_newline(out);
 
-       out->tabstops[0] = 20;
-       out->tabstops[1] = 36;
+       printbuf_tabstops_reset(out);
+       printbuf_tabstop_push(out, 20);
+       printbuf_tabstop_push(out, 16);
 
        prt_str(out, "Size:");
        prt_tab(out);
@@ -202,10 +203,11 @@ static void fs_usage_to_text(struct printbuf *out, const char *path)
 
        prt_newline(out);
 
-       out->tabstops[0] = 16;
-       out->tabstops[1] = 32;
-       out->tabstops[2] = 50;
-       out->tabstops[3] = 68;
+       printbuf_tabstops_reset(out);
+       printbuf_tabstop_push(out, 16);
+       printbuf_tabstop_push(out, 16);
+       printbuf_tabstop_push(out, 18);
+       printbuf_tabstop_push(out, 18);
 
        prt_str(out, "Data type");
        prt_tab(out);
@@ -255,10 +257,11 @@ static void fs_usage_to_text(struct printbuf *out, const char *path)
        sort(dev_names.data, dev_names.nr,
             sizeof(dev_names.data[0]), dev_by_label_cmp, NULL);
 
-       out->tabstops[0] = 16;
-       out->tabstops[1] = 36;
-       out->tabstops[2] = 52;
-       out->tabstops[3] = 68;
+       printbuf_tabstops_reset(out);
+       printbuf_tabstop_push(out, 16);
+       printbuf_tabstop_push(out, 20);
+       printbuf_tabstop_push(out, 16);
+       printbuf_tabstop_push(out, 14);
 
        darray_for_each(dev_names, dev)
                dev_usage_to_text(out, fs, dev);